Sure. They are standard Model 24 Stielhandgranate ("potato mashers" as the Brits know them). They are inscribed with the words, Vor Gebrauch Sprengkapsel einsetzen.
Range: 8/15/30
Damage: 3d6
Weight: 2 lbs.
Burst: Medium

Since I had to look up the rules myself, now seems as good a time as any to have a brief reiteration of the DAMAGE! rules.
Pg 68:
"Wild Cards can take three wounds and still function. If another wound would be caused after that, they’re Incapacitated"
pg 69:
"Wild Cards are Incapacitated if they suffer more than three wounds (cumulatively or all at once). When a Wild Card becomes Incapacitated, make an immediate Vigor roll:
• Total of 1 or Less: The character dies.
• Failure: Roll on the Injury Table..."
I'm guessing that WhtKnt thought an Injury cometh automatically upon becoming Incapacitated, though it looks like we're given one last chance to suck before that happens. =)
